Leilei Wang is a scholar working on Health, Toxicology and Mutagenesis, Water Science and Technology and Ecology. According to data from OpenAlex, Leilei Wang has authored 20 papers receiving a total of 764 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 8 papers in Health, Toxicology and Mutagenesis, 5 papers in Water Science and Technology and 3 papers in Ecology. Recurrent topics in Leilei Wang's work include Trace Elements in Health (3 papers), Water Treatment and Disinfection (3 papers) and Heavy Metal Exposure and Toxicity (3 papers). Leilei Wang is often cited by papers focused on Trace Elements in Health (3 papers), Water Treatment and Disinfection (3 papers) and Heavy Metal Exposure and Toxicity (3 papers). Leilei Wang collaborates with scholars based in China, United States and Poland. Leilei Wang's co-authors include Shiying Yang, Rui Niu, Xin Yang, Xueting Shao, Lijia Liu, Jiming Hu, Xiaodong Zhou, Zhen Zhang, Tao Lin and Wei Chen and has published in prestigious journals such as SHILAP Revista de lepidopterología, Journal of Hazardous Materials and International Journal of Molecular Sciences.
